Taking place between 7 and 13 February 2022, Apprenticeship Week is an annual week-long celebration of apprenticeships, and the value they bring to employers and learners in Wales. Apprenticeships allow businesses to recruit new talent, hungry to learn, to fills skills gaps cost-effectively and enable learners, of any age, to increase their skills levels. The Geovation Accelerator Programme is backed by Ordnance Survey and HM Land Registry. The Programme offers 6 months intensive support, structured to each start-ups needs aimed at help founders grow their business. Start-ups receive up to £20,000 grant funding and the equivalent to over £100,000 in benefits on the Programme. The Welsh Government is investing a further £4.5 million of capital funding this year in new sport facilities across Wales, Deputy Minister for Arts and Sport, Dawn Bowden has announced. The additional capital funding will support projects to enhance facilities, which will help drive increased participation across a wide range of sports. From April, employers will be obliged to provide personal protective equipment (PPE) to workers, as well as employees, who may be exposed to health and safety risks at work. An amendment to the Personal Protective Equipment at Work Regulations 1992, will come into force on 6 April 2022. Businesses are reminded to take steps to prepare for Making Tax Digital for Value Added Tax (VAT) before it becomes mandatory for all VAT-registered businesses from 1 April this year. Making Tax Digital is designed to help businesses eliminate common errors and save time managing their tax affairs. Making Tax Digital for VAT is part of the overall digitalisation of UK Tax. Rent Smart Wales assists those who let or manage rental properties in Wales to comply with their Housing (Wales) Act 2014 obligations and provides advice on renting out safe and healthy homes. They also process landlord registrations, grant licences and deliver informative and relevant training for those involved in the rental market both online and in classroom venues across Wales. People who test positive for Covid-19 will be able to leave self-isolation after 5 full days if they have 2 negative lateral flow tests, Health Minister Eluned Morgan today confirmed. The 2 consecutive negative lateral flow tests must be taken on days 5 and 6 of the isolation period.
